Abstract
We show that single Higgs production in gamma gamma collisions through laser backscattering provides the best way to look for New Physics (N P) effects inducing anomalous Higgs couplings. Our analysis is based o n the four dim = 6 operators O-UB, O-UW, <(O)over bar(UB)> and <(O)ove r bar(UW)>, which describe New Physics effects in this sector. Using t he Higgs production rate we establish observability limits for the cou plings of the aforementioned operators at a level of 10(-3), which mea ns establishing lower bounds on the scale of NP of the order 30 to 200 TeV. Higgs branching ratios, especially the ratio Gamma(H --> gamma g amma)/Gamma(H --> gamma Z), are shown to provide powerful ways to dise ntangle the effects of the various operators.
